K210做烟雾报警器,用MicroPython还是C语言更省事?
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
《MicroPython从0到1》基于K210平台
"MicroPython从0到1"基于K210平台 本资源摘要信息旨在介绍MicroPython的基础知识和应用,基于K210平台的开发环境。MicroPython是一个轻量级的Python实现,旨在嵌入式系统中运行,提供了方便的开发方式和强大的功能...
K210-Micropython-OpenMV
《K210-Micropython-OpenMV:探索AI微控制器的世界》 在智能硬件领域,K210是一款备受瞩目的微控制器,它以其强大的处理能力与丰富的硬件资源,为开发人员提供了构建低功耗、高性能的物联网(IoT)应用的新选择。这个...
用于超声波传感器HC-SR04 的 Micropython 驱动程序_Python_代码_相关文件_下载
micropython 中现有的驱动程序有点老了,他们没有使用相对较新的方法machine.time_pulse_us(),这比使用纯 python 的任何其他方法更准确,除了代码符合“标准”micropython,没有特定板的代码。 最后,我distance_...
【雕爷学编程】MicroPython动手做(02)——尝试搭建K210开发板的IDE环境
春节新冠疫情过后,我入手了一块支持MicroPython的开发板(性价比还行,百多元),国产自主知识产权的K210芯片,从零开始学习,尝试动手做实验。 自2018年9月6日,嘉楠科技推出自主设计研发的全球首款基于RISC-V的...
2021全国大学生电子设计大赛F题2辆车(C语言编写)+2个K210程序(Python编写)源码+学习说明.zip
1、该资源包括项目的全部源码,下载可以直接使用! 2、本项目适合作为计算机、数学、电子信息等专业的竞赛项目学习资料,作为参考学习借鉴。 3、本资源作为“参考资料”如果需要实现其他功能,需要能看懂代码,并且...
2021全国大学生电子设计大赛F题(代码全部开源:2辆车(C语言编写)+2个K210程序(Python编写)).zip
K210芯片的开发通常需要使用特定的框架和库,如MaixPy或Sipeed Micropython,它们为开发者提供了便捷的API接口,使得在Python中编程K210变得简单。开发者可能需要掌握K210的GPIO(通用输入/输出)、SPI、I2C等接口的...
【Python编程】Python机器学习Scikit-learn核心API设计
内容概要:本文深入剖析Scikit-learn的统一样式API设计哲学,重点对比估计器(Estimator)、预测器(Predictor)、转换器(Transformer)三类接口的契约规范与组合模式。文章从fit/predict/fit_transform方法约定出发,详解Pipeline的顺序执行与参数网格搜索(GridSearchCV)的超参数优化、以及FeatureUnion的并行特征拼接机制。通过代码示例展示自定义估计器的BaseEstimator继承与get_params/set_params实现、交叉验证(cross_val_score)的K折策略与分层抽样、以及模型持久化(joblib/pickle)的版本兼容性,同时介绍ColumnTransformer的异构数据处理、自定义评分指标(make_scorer)的业务适配、以及模型解释性(SHAP/LIME)的集成方案,最后给出在特征工程流水线、模型选择、生产部署等场景下的Scikit-learn最佳实践与版本迁移策略。
【Python编程】NumPy数组操作与广播机制深度解析
内容概要:本文系统讲解NumPy多维数组的核心操作,重点对比ndarray与Python列表在内存布局、向量化运算、广播规则上的本质差异。文章从C连续与F连续内存顺序出发,详解视图(view)与副本(copy)的引用语义、花式索引(fancy indexing)的数组拷贝行为、以及结构化数组的复合数据类型。通过性能基准测试展示ufunc通用函数的SIMD加速、广播机制在形状不匹配数组运算中的自动扩展规则、以及einsum爱因斯坦求和约定的灵活张量操作,同时介绍memmap大数组内存映射、record array的数据库式字段访问、以及NumPy与Cython的混合加速策略,最后给出在图像处理、数值模拟、机器学习特征工程等场景下的数组优化技巧与内存管理建议。
【Python编程】Python字典与集合底层实现原理
内容概要:本文深入剖析Python字典(dict)与集合(set)的哈希表底层实现机制,重点讲解哈希冲突解决策略、负载因子动态调整、键的可哈希性要求等核心概念。文章从开放寻址法与分离链接法的对比入手,分析Python 3.6+版本字典的有序性保证原理,探讨集合的去重逻辑与数学运算实现。通过sys.getsizeof对比不同规模数据的内存占用,展示哈希表扩容与缩容的触发条件,同时介绍frozenset的不可变特性及其作为字典键的应用场景,最后给出在成员检测、数据去重、缓存实现等场景下的性能优化建议。 24直播网:www.nbalawen.com 24直播网:www.nbatelexi.com 24直播网:www.nbagebeier.com 24直播网:www.nbaxiyakamu.com 24直播网:www.nbayinggelamu.com
K210 环境检测.zip
综合以上分析,这个项目利用K210微控制器搭建了一个环境监测系统,包括温湿度(通过DHT22)、光照(可能通过PCF8591和附加的光敏传感器)和烟雾(可能使用专门的烟雾传感器)的实时监测。软件部分主要由Python编写,...
k210使用openmv库所需固件
k210使用openmv库所需固件
基于K210的数字识别,识别率94%
标题中的“基于K210的数字识别,识别率94%”指的是使用K210微控制器进行数字图像处理并实现高精度的数字识别。K210是一款由中国的平头哥半导体公司(现隶属于阿里巴巴集团)设计的低功耗、高性能的RISC-V双核处理器...
K210xianyu.Dzk
K210字库文件,放到SD卡引用即可。使用方法image.font_load(image.UTF8, 16, 16, '/sd/xianyu.Dzk')
K210 车牌识别项目单片机代码,所用语言为C语言
K210 车牌识别项目单片机代码,所用语言为C语言
亚博K210模型训练部署
亚博K210是基于 Kendryte K210 芯片的微型计算机板,具有强大的计算能力和人工智能计算能力。该板卡可以广泛应用于机器学习、计算机视觉、自然语言处理等领域。下面是关于亚博K210 模型训练部署的知识点: 一、模型...
亚博智能k210模块-基于canmv训练识别数字
亚博智能K210模块是一款专为嵌入式人工智能应用设计的微控制器,它集成了高效的硬件加速器,能够处理复杂的机器学习任务,如数字识别。基于CANMV(可能是"Computer Vision on Microcontrollers"的缩写)训练的数字...
基于K210开发板的配套资料.zip
K210开发板是一款集成了强大硬件资源的微控制器,特别适用于低功耗、高性能的IoT应用。这款开发板以其内置的双核64位RISC-V CPU、丰富的外围接口以及神经网络加速器而受到开发者们的广泛关注。在"基于K210开发板的...
k210官方板子烧录固件,maixpy安装包,人脸识别kmodel,固件bin包,Pyloader,kflash等等所有软件
K210的AI加速器使其能够高效运行这些模型,即使在资源有限的环境中也能实现实时的人脸识别功能。 Pyloader是一个固件升级工具,它可以将固件文件加载到K210芯片中,通常用于开发和调试阶段。这个工具简化了固件更新...
人脸识别C语言源代码实现
这可以通过经典的Haar特征级联分类器或者更现代的方法如Dlib库中的HOG+SVM实现。不过,根据提供的描述,这里使用的是基于PCA的人脸检测,这可能涉及到从训练集构建人脸模板,并用这些模板来检测新图像中的人脸。 3....
K210人脸识别+断电存储程序和软件安装包
使用适合K210芯片的开发工具和语言(如MicroPython、C语言等),开发人脸识别和断电存储的软件。 实现人脸识别算法的集成和优化,确保在资源有限的环境下也能够高效运行。 测试与优化: 对软件进行全面测试,确保...
最新推荐



